Phoenix, AZ (Sports Network) - The Phoenix Suns officially welcomed back guard Goran Dragic to the team on Thursday when he signed a four-year contract worth a reported $30 million.

Dragic played with the Suns the first two-plus seasons of his NBA career before being traded to Houston in the Aaron Brooks deal in February 2011. He averaged a career-best 11.7 points while not missing a game last season.

Dragic, 26, was acquired by the Suns in a draft-day deal from San Antonio in 2008. He lifted his game being a part-time starter for the Rockets this past season by compiling a career-best 5.3 assists.

Dragic figures to get plenty of playing time at the point in Phoenix now that Steve Nash has been traded to the Lakers.
